JAC Group appointed by Investec Asset Management

The JAC Group Project Management team are delighted to have been appointed by Investec Asset Management to oversee their London office relocation project from Woolgate Exchange to 55 Gresham Street, London.

55 Gresham Street was acquired by Angelo Gordon and Beltane in 2014. The head lease with the City of London Corporation was re-geared and planning consent secured for a major redevelopment designed by Fletcher Priest Architects.

The comprehensive redevelopment of the building will deliver 121,600 sq ft of prime office space across 11 floors, located in the centre of the City of London’s financial district in June 2020.

Duncan Roe, partner at Beltane, said: “The fact that Investec Asset Management, a distinctive global organisation, has decided to relocate to 55 Gresham Street prior to its completion, is an endorsement of the quality of the development. The deal also represents the area’s continued pull for financial occupiers who remain committed to the City of London.”

JLL and Cushman & Wakefield advised Angelo Gordon and Beltane Asset Management; Devono Cresa acted on behalf of Investec Asset Management.

JAC Group appointed by Statkraft

 

JAC Group are pleased to have been instructed to project manage Statkraft’s fit-out project, to the 19th floor of the landmark 22 Bishopsgate building.

The project is in the early phases of feasibility and concept design with a design and build contractor now having been appointed.

Given the complexities of the project an independent mechanical and electrical consultant has been brought into the project team to set the design criteria for the heating, cooling, fresh air, lighting, power and data provisions. They will be on hand throughout the build phase of the project to ensure that these aspects are built to specification and in line with Statkraft’s signed off drawings.

The stature of the base build means the landlord approval process requires close monitoring and coordination, including coordinated commissioning, site logistics, monitoring and phased licence to alter approvals.

The design of the office is outstanding and this looks set to be a fantastic space in a fantastic London building for Statkraft.

JAC Group appointed by Peel Hunt

JAC Group are delighted to announce that the JAC project management team has been appointed to assist Peel Hunt in their forthcoming relocation from Moor House to Broadgate’s latest office development, 100 Liverpool St.

The major 521,000 sq. ft office-led refurbishment project at 100 Liverpool Street includes 3 additional storeys, targets BREEAM Excellence rating for sustainability and boasts 90,000 sq. ft dedicated to retail, restaurants, cafés and bars.

Taking over approximately 40,000 sq. ft, the 7th floor of 100 Liverpool will be a superb location for Peel Hunt and will certainly enhance workplace efficiency as their two London offices combine.

JAC Group appointed by Euler Hermes

JAC Group is extremely pleased to announce that JAC Project Management & JAC Design have both been appointed by Euler Hermes.

The Euler Hermes London team are consolidating on to one floor from two in the iconic One Canada Square. Having taken the opportunity to conduct extensive analysis of their current ways of working and carrying out workplace questionnaires Euler Hermes are in the process of creating what will be a stunning working environment.

With the space undergoing a complete strip out and a new CAT A provision being installed there is a fantastic opportunity to influence the CAT B design driving cost efficiencies through the scheme.

We look forward to continuing our relationship with the Euler Hermes London team and seeing this project through the coming stages of detail design, tender, build and relocation
